eIDAS 2.0 Digital Identity Wallets: A Standardized Future
eIDAS 2.0 represents a significant leap forward in digital identity within the European Union. Its core component, the European Digital Identity Wallet, is designed to provide all EU citizens and residents with a secure and convenient way to prove their identity and share attributes across borders. These wallets will be issued by Member States, ensuring a high level of trust and legal recognition.
The key strengths of eIDAS 2.0 wallets lie in their standardization and interoperability. They are built on a common framework, meaning a digital ID issued in one EU country will be recognized and accepted throughout the Union. This facilitates cross-border services, reduces red tape, and enhances the digital single market. For businesses, this means a more predictable and unified environment for verifying customer identities, simplifying compliance with regulations like KYC (Know Your Customer) and AML (Anti-Money Laundering). However, the implementation of such a large-scale, standardized system can be complex and time-consuming. While the vision is clear, the practical rollout and widespread adoption will require significant coordination and investment from member states and private sector entities alike.
Proprietary Digital Identity Applications: Innovation and Flexibility
In contrast to the top-down, standardized approach of eIDAS 2.0, proprietary digital identity apps are developed by individual companies, often for specific industries or use cases. These can range from banking apps with integrated identity verification features to dedicated identity platforms that serve a variety of businesses. Their primary advantage lies in their flexibility, speed of innovation, and ability to cater to niche market demands.
Proprietary apps can quickly adapt to new technologies and user expectations, offering cutting-edge features like advanced biometric authentication (1:1 Face Match & Face Search), sophisticated fraud prevention (Passive & Active Liveness Detection), and customisable user journeys. They often provide a more tailored experience, integrating seamlessly with a company's existing services and branding. The challenge with proprietary solutions, however, is the potential for fragmentation. A user might need multiple digital ID apps for different services, leading to a less cohesive experience. Furthermore, the level of trust and legal recognition can vary significantly between different proprietary providers, depending on their security measures and regulatory adherence.
Key Differences and Their Impact
The fundamental differences between eIDAS 2.0 wallets and proprietary apps boil down to standardization vs. customization, and regulatory backing vs. market-driven innovation.
- Interoperability: eIDAS 2.0 wallets are inherently designed for cross-border interoperability within the EU. Proprietary apps, while they can offer API integrations, typically lack this universal recognition unless they explicitly align with common standards.
- Trust and Assurance: eIDAS 2.0 wallets will carry the weight of government backing and standardized security levels, offering a high degree of legal certainty and trust. Proprietary apps must earn user trust through their own security track record and compliance with relevant industry standards.
- Scope and Use Cases: eIDAS 2.0 aims to cover a broad spectrum of public and private services across the EU. Proprietary apps often excel in specific domains, offering highly optimized solutions for particular business needs, such as secure access to a banking portal or age verification for online content.
- Development and Deployment: Proprietary apps can be developed and deployed relatively quickly, allowing for agile responses to market needs. eIDAS 2.0, as a large-scale public infrastructure project, involves a longer development and rollout timeline.
